色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

如何創建MySQL好友關系表(詳細教程帶你輕松搞定)

錢淋西2年前42瀏覽0評論

問:如何創建MySQL好友關系表?

答:MySQL好友關系表是用于存儲用戶之間好友關系的表格。它可以記錄用戶之間的互動和交流,是社交網站和應用程序中必不可少的一部分。下面是創建MySQL好友關系表的詳細步驟:

步驟1:創建數據庫

ds”的數據庫:

步驟2:創建表格

dships”的表格來存儲好友關系。可以使用以下命令創建一個包含以下字段的表格:

dships (

id INT(11) NOT NULL AUTO_INCREMENT,

user_id INT(11) NOT NULL,d_id INT(11) NOT NULL,

status INT(11) NOT NULL DEFAULT 0,

created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P,

updated_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P,

PRIMARY KEY (id),iquedshipd_id)

在這個表格中,我們定義了以下字段:

- id:主鍵,自動遞增。

- user_id:用戶ID,表示好友關系的發起者。d_id:好友ID,表示好友關系的接受者。

- status:好友關系的狀態,0表示未確認,1表示已確認,-1表示已拒絕。

- created_at:創建時間,表示好友關系的創建時間。

- updated_at:更新時間,表示好友關系的最后更新時間。iquedship:唯一索引,用于確保每個好友關系只能被記錄一次。

步驟3:插入數據

現在,我們可以向表格中插入數據來記錄好友關系。可以使用以下命令插入一些示例數據:

dshipsd_id) VALUES

(1, 2),

(1, 3),

(2, 3),

(3, 4);

這些數據表示以下好友關系:

- 用戶1和用戶2是好友。

- 用戶1和用戶3是好友。

- 用戶2和用戶3是好友。

- 用戶3和用戶4是好友。

步驟4:查詢數據

最后,我們可以使用SELECT語句查詢好友關系表中的數據。以下是一些示例查詢:

-- 查詢用戶1的好友dships WHERE user_id = 1 AND status = 1;

-- 查詢用戶2的好友dships WHERE user_id = 2 AND status = 1;

-- 查詢用戶3的好友dships WHERE user_id = 3 AND status = 1;

-- 查詢所有好友關系dships;

這些查詢將返回不同的結果,以便您可以查看好友關系表中存儲的數據。

以上就是創建MySQL好友關系表的詳細步驟。通過創建這個表格,您可以輕松地記錄用戶之間的好友關系,并在需要時查詢這些關系。